On pure AMA Championships (between the three classes) Kawasaki has won 25 times, Suzuki 12 times, Yamaha 9 times, KTM 8 times, Honda seven times and Husqvarna two times over the past 20 years. The Super Bowl of Motocross II held the following year was an even greater success and, eventually evolved into the AMA Supercross championship held in stadiums across the United States and Canada.[5]. Privacy | Race Fees = $30 per class. 47. David Pingree (4) Ryan Villopoto (41) 6. The easy accessibility and comfort of these stadium venues helped supercross surpass off-road motocross as a spectator attraction in the United States by the late 1970s. In 2006, the 250cc division was renamed the MX Class, with an engine formula allowing for 150250cc two-stroke or 250450cc four-stroke machines.
